  • Abstract
    Two encoding schemes aimed at improving the glitch performance of flash D/A converters are proposed. The schemes use an encoding with linearly increasing source weights. Estimates based on a first-order model of the relative error due to glitches show an improvement with several orders of magnitude over existing D/A converters
